Understanding What a Fast Charging Cable Is
A fast charging cable is specifically built to support higher electrical current and voltage, allowing compatible devices to charge more quickly than with standard cables. Unlike basic charging cables, fast charging cables use thicker internal wires and better insulation to safely carry more power.
It is important to note that fast charging depends on a combination of factors. The cable, the charger, and the device must all support fast charging standards. Even the most powerful adapter will not deliver fast charging if the cable cannot handle the required power.
How Fast Charging Technology Works
Fast charging technology works by increasing the amount of power delivered to a device’s battery in a controlled and efficient manner. Traditional charging usually delivers lower power, resulting in longer charging times. A fast charging cable allows higher current flow while maintaining safety and stability.
Power Delivery and Current Capacity
Fast charging cables are designed to support higher current levels, often up to three or five amps, depending on the standard. This higher current allows devices to charge significantly faster, especially during the initial charging phase.
Communication Between Devices
Modern fast charging systems involve communication between the device, charger, and cable. This communication ensures that the correct amount of power is delivered without overheating or damaging the battery. High-quality fast charging cables include chips or wiring that support this communication.
Types of Fast Charging Cables
There are several types of fast charging cables available, each designed for specific devices and charging standards.
USB Type C Fast Charging Cable
USB Type C is the most widely used fast charging cable type today. It supports high power output and fast data transfer, making it suitable for smartphones, tablets, laptops, and other devices. USB Type C cables are reversible, which adds to their convenience.
Many fast charging technologies rely on USB Type C due to its ability to handle higher power levels efficiently.
USB to Lightning Fast Charging Cable
This type of fast charging cable is designed for Apple devices. When paired with compatible chargers, it enables faster charging for iPhones and iPads. These cables are built to meet specific performance and safety requirements.
Micro USB Fast Charging Cable
Although Micro USB is gradually being replaced by USB Type C, some fast charging cables are still available for older devices. These cables support faster charging than standard Micro USB cables but are limited compared to newer technologies.

Factors That Affect Fast Charging Performance
Not all fast charging experiences are the same. Several factors influence how effectively a fast charging cable performs.
Charger and Power Adapter Quality
A fast charging cable must be paired with a compatible charger to deliver optimal results. Using a low-power adapter can limit charging speed, even with a high-quality cable.
Device Compatibility
The device itself must support fast charging technology. Older devices may not benefit fully from a fast charging cable.
Cable Length and Build Quality
Longer cables may experience slight power loss, especially if they are poorly constructed. High-quality materials and proper insulation help maintain performance.
Build Quality and Materials in Fast Charging Cables
The durability of a fast charging cable depends heavily on the materials used in its construction.
Internal Wiring
Thicker copper wiring allows the cable to handle higher current without overheating. This is a key feature of reliable fast charging cables.
Outer Coating
Braided nylon or reinforced plastic coatings protect the cable from bending, twisting, and daily wear. These materials extend the lifespan of the cable.
Connector Strength
Strong and well-designed connectors prevent loose connections and reduce the risk of damage to device ports.

Common Misconceptions About Fast Charging Cables
Many users believe that any cable labeled as fast charging will deliver the same performance. In reality, quality and specifications vary widely.
Another misconception is that fast charging damages batteries. When used with certified chargers and cables, fast charging is designed to be safe and efficient.
Understanding these misconceptions helps users make better choices and avoid unnecessary concerns.
